Skip to content
This repository was archived by the owner on Mar 23, 2026. It is now read-only.

Commit f8172e8

Browse files
committed
fix NPE
1 parent d59ee75 commit f8172e8

1 file changed

Lines changed: 4 additions & 2 deletions

File tree

google-cloud-bigquery/src/main/java/com/google/cloud/bigquery/LoadJobConfiguration.java

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-228,9 +228,11 @@ private Builder(com.google.api.services.bigquery.model.JobConfiguration configur
228228
CsvOptions.newBuilder()
229229
.setEncoding(loadConfigurationPb.getEncoding())
230230
.setFieldDelimiter(loadConfigurationPb.getFieldDelimiter())
231-
.setPreserveAsciiControlCharacters(
232-
loadConfigurationPb.getPreserveAsciiControlCharacters())
233231
.setQuote(loadConfigurationPb.getQuote());
232+
if (loadConfigurationPb.getPreserveAsciiControlCharacters() != null) {
233+
builder.setPreserveAsciiControlCharacters(
234+
loadConfigurationPb.getPreserveAsciiControlCharacters());
235+
}
234236
if (loadConfigurationPb.getAllowJaggedRows() != null) {
235237
builder.setAllowJaggedRows(loadConfigurationPb.getAllowJaggedRows());
236238
}

0 commit comments

Comments
 (0)